Tyreman Group plans to develop a software for industrial symbiosis

Since August 2019 Tyreman Group researches the potential industrial symbiosis chains development among companies of North-West Russia within the “Baltic Industrial Symbiosis” international project of Program of cross-border cooperation "Interreg. The Baltic Sea Region 2014-2020". During that time Tyreman Group experts have studied an international experience of the development of industrial symbiotic chains in Denmark and Norway (also by fam trips to industrial sites of international partners) and analysed practices of collaboration within industrial symbiosis cases. The team of the Project participated in more than 60 meetings with industrial companies of North-West Russia.

During the preliminary studies Tyreman Group found that some Saint-Petersburg and Leningrad region companies have needs both in proceeding wastes for increase of income and in getting secondary materials that are cheaper than ordinary ones. To meet their needs Tyreman Group plans to develop a state-of-the-art software – multifunctional digital platform.

This platform would provide the following services:
1)   Companies would be able to find partners for the development of industrial symbiotic chains really fast and cheap;
2)   There would be a list of all the existing wastes/secondary resources that could be used with an exact geographical location;
3)   Information provided by the companies would be analysed in order to understand a potential value of wastes and possibility to use it as a secondary material in different symbiotic chains.

In absence of such platform companies spend too much time and money for finding new potential partners. The platform will make it easier and will help to develop new industrial symbiotic chains.
